The Greenbone Security Manager (GSM) is a dedicated Vulnerability Management security appliance. It integrates transparently into your vulnerability and threat management system.
With a choice of front-ends, security scans can give you full visibility of vulnerabilities in your network. The scan also identifies potential breaches of your corporate security policy and regulations.

Specification
- Construction
- 1U rack mount chassis, heavy-duty steel
- 16 x 2 character LCD display
- Connectivity
- 4 Port GbE 10/100/1000 Base-TX (Copper)
- 4 Port GbE SFP (Copper or Fiber)
- 1 Port Serial Console RS-232
- Dimensions
- 427mm x 480mm x 44mm
- Environment
- Operating temperature: 0° to 40°C (32° to 104°F)
- Storage temperature: -20° to 80°C (-4° to 176° F)
- Humidity: 10% to 90% (non-condensing)
- Certifications
- CE
- FCC Class A
Features
- Supported standards
- Network integration: SMTP (Email), SysLog, NTP, DHCP, IPv4/IPv6
- Vulnerability detection: CVE, CPE, OVAL
- Network scans: WMI, LDAP, HTTP, SMB, SSH, TCP, UDP, ...
- Application web-based interface (HTTPS)
- Scan tasks management
- Multi-user support
- Report browsing aided by filtering and sorting
- Report export as PDF or XML
- Appliance performance overview
- Application remote control (SSL-secured OMP)
- OpenVAS Management Protocol (OMP)
- All user actions of web-based interface available
- Supported by desktop applications (for Unix-like operating systems)
- Automated via scriptable command line tools (for Unix-like operating systems)
- Administrative console interface (shell via SSHv2 or RS232)
- Network integration configuration
- Backup, Restore, Snapshot, Factory Reset, Update
- Includes approved and customized versions of
- Scan Engine: OpenVAS Scanner, OpenVAS Manager, OpenVAS Administrator and Greenbone Security Assistant
- Scan Tools: Nmap, w3af
